Stas Mikhaylov

Stanislav Vladimirovich Mikhaylov (Russian: Станислав Владимирович Михайлов), better known as Stas Mikhaylov (Russian: Стас Михайлов, born 27 April 1969 in Sochi, Russia) is a popular Russian singer and songwriter,[1] Meritorious Artist of the Russian Federation (2010);[2] laureate of the Russian National Music Award[3] and the Golden Gramophone Award.[4] Stas Mikhaylov reported the highest income of all singers in Russia in 2011 with $20 million[5] and 2012 with $21 million[6]

Mikhaylov is best known for his songs Dlya tebya (lit. For you) and Nu vot i vsyo. The first of those became the most well-known among the releases of singer.[7]
